U.S. crypto asset management firm Grayscale has submitted a filing related to Horizen Trust (ZEN) to the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

According to BlockBeats on the 24th, Grayscale submitted a Form 8-K document related to ZEN to the U.S. SEC on the 23rd (local time). Form 8-K is a report that a listed company must immediately submit to the SEC when significant events or information occur.
